    Freedom 800
    The Freedom 800 series features an interior glazed sash for optimum weather protection and curb appeal, in addition to rigid form-fitting PVC cladding that is fully welded at the top corners, providing a clean appearance, traditional, narrow-line look and further protection from the weather. The Freedom 800 series also comes standard with energy-efficient Warm Edge Insulated Glass and convenient easy-tilt sash for simple tilt-in cleaning of exterior glass. Exterior features include cladding offered in White, Sandalwood and Taupe, an integral face accessory groove and a pre-punched nailing flange for easy installation and accessory application.

    A standard clear wood interior ready for painting or staining provides homeowners flexibility to coordinate their windows and patio doors with any interior décor. The Freedom 800 series is available in double hung, casement/awning, picture and patio door styles, with combinations such as singles, twins, triples, quads, bows and a wide selection of special shapes to solve any design challenge. Additional options include: simulated-divided-lite (SDL) with shadow bar; grille-between-the-glass (GBG) in flat, and sculptured styles; removable wood grilles; color-matched extension jambs; and a full-length fiberglass screen with a rigid aluminum frame.

    Freedom 600
    The weather-resistant Freedom 600 series features a fully welded, all-vinyl sash, creating a larger daylight viewing area, and a wood frame treated with water-repellant preservative and covered with rigid, form-fitting PVC cladding, eliminating the need for on-site painting. With a prefinished white interior, the 600 series also features energy-efficient Warm Edge Insulated Glass, a robust interlock design satisfying forced entry requirements and a nailing fin with overlapping corners, making installation easy.

    The Freedom 600 series is available in double hung, casement/awning and picture styles, with optional add-ons including SDL and an easy-tilt sash. Grille options include GBG in flat and sculptured styles.

    Patio Doors
    The MW Freedom Series of patio doors is available in sliding, hinged, French sliding and French hinged styles. The patio doors have a combination of vinyl cladding and pultruded fiberglass exterior components providing maintenance-free benefits, while the natural wood interior comes ready for paint or stain. Three-quarter inch tempered insulated glass and a multi-point locking system also are standard with all MW Freedom Series patio doors. Many popular hardware finishes, including bright brass, antique brass, oil rubbed bronze and satin nickel, are available to blend seamlessly with existing décor. Grille options for MW Freedom Series patio doors include SDL and GBG in flat and sculptured styles.

    Energy-saving glazing options for all MW Freedom Series offerings include: Low-E, Tinted, Low-E/Argon, Low-E/Tinted, Tempered and Obscure. All MW Freedom Series windows and doors feature a 20-year glass warranty, and can be configured to meet ENERGY STAR® program requirements for all climate zones.

    About MW Windows & Doors
    MW Windows & Doors is a brand of MW Manufacturers Inc., Rocky Mount, Va. Founded in 1939, MW was one of the first window companies in the country to build a window and frame together as a single unit ready for installation into a rough opening. Today, MW offers a complete line of clad wood, wood, composite and vinyl windows and patio doors. MW is owned by Ply Gem Industries, Inc., headquartered in Kearney, Mo. Ply Gem manufactures and distributes a range of products for use in the residential new construction, do-it-yourself and professional renovation markets. Principal products include vinyl siding, windows, patio doors, fencing, railing, decking and accessories marketed under the MW, Variform, Great Lakes, Napco, Alenco, Kroy and CWD brand names.
